Result of National Final
| № | Singer | Song | Points | % of vote | Place |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Treble | "Amambanda" | 90720 | 72% | 1st |
| 2 | Behave | "Heaven Knows" | 18900 | 15% | 2nd |
| 3 | Maud | "I'm Alive" | 16380 | 13% | 3rd |
